Workweek Outlook: Sunny skies and an October heat surge

By the end of the week, we will see temperatures 5-10 degrees above normal for mid-October
weather_weekday_outlook

High pressure builds into the Great Lakes region, bringing sunshine for most of this shortened workweek without risk of rain (or snow). As the high pressure moves east, it will allow for a southerly flow that brings warmer-than-normal air into the Sault region. By the end of the week, we will see temperatures 5-10 degrees above normal for mid-October.

Monday brings a mix of sun and cloud with daytime highs of 9°C. Gusty north winds will make it feel more like 5°C. Sunshine returns Tuesday, with temperatures climbing to 12°C in the afternoon.

Sunny skies continue into Thursday and Friday, with a southerly wind that helps push daytime highs to 17°C and 18°C.

We could see a few clouds move in this weekend, but temperatures remain in the mid to upper teens and well above normal.
